A look at the day ahead in Asian markets.Japanese consumer confidence and Australian inflation are the main points of focus for markets in Asia on Wednesday, as investors ponder the broader implications of a widespread rise in bond yields.U.S.

The Dow fell, the S&P 500 was flat and Nvidia's extraordinary rally powered the Nasdaq to a fresh record high - shares in the AI poster child have soared 20 per cent in the last three trading days and the firm is now worth $2.8 trillion. The 10-year JGB yield rose for an eighth straight day on Tuesday to hit a fresh 12-year high of 1.035 per cent, and the 2-year JGB yield inched up to a new 15-year peak of 0.36 per cent.
